America Needs to ‘Seek God’ Amid Darkness, Says Christian Artist Sean Feucht

December 29, 2021 by Staff

(Fox News) Christian singer and songwriter Sean Feucht stressed the importance of worship, saying “God is the answer and hope for America” during Tuesday’s “Fox News Primetime.”

“It wasn’t America that founded religious liberty — religious liberty founded America,” Feucht said. “It’s essential to who we are and especially in a time of a pandemic, especially in a time where there’s such division and there’s such isolation.”

Feucht is the founder of the Let Us Worship movement where he first began leading worship events in major American cities during the summer of 2020. He announced a 2022 tour earlier in December with the first event ringing in the New Year in Miami, Florida with dates through October.
